Cultural Life in the Iranian Community
Little Tehran is more than restaurants and politics.
It is also a vibrant cultural hub.
Events often include:
-
Persian poetry readings
-
Iranian film screenings
-
Music performances
-
Nowruz celebrations
The Persian New Year, known as Nowruz, is one of the most important cultural celebrations.
During Nowruz, shops decorate their windows with:
-
Haft-seen tables
-
Flowers
-
Traditional sweets
Families gather to celebrate renewal and hope.
